XML 17 R5.htm IDEA: XBRL DOCUMENT v3.25.0.1
Consolidated Balance Sheet (Parenthetical) - USD ($)
$ in Millions
Dec. 31, 2024
Dec. 31, 2023
Statement of Financial Position [Abstract]    
Fiduciary cash $ 5,481.3 $ 5,571.8
Deferred income tax credit carryforwards $ 771.8 $ 867.4
Common stock - authorized shares 400,000,000 400,000,000
Common stock - issued shares 250,000,000 216,700,000
Common stock - outstanding shares 250,000,000 216,700,000